超细铜线拉制过程中断线原因分析与解决对策

【摘要】 超细铜线是一种具有广泛应用前景的高技术产品,其生产难度较大,在生产过程中常常发生断线,困扰其正常生产。本文通过对超细铜线拉制过程中断线断口的显微分析,探索了超细铜线拉制时断线的产生原因,认为断线产生原因包括铜线坯的气孔、疏松、夹杂、表面缺陷、塑性不足以及铜线变形不均、变形力过大、工模具损耗、设备精度及平稳性等。在缺陷分析及大量工业实践的基础上提出了断线的解决对策,认为通过原材料优选、模具优化、润滑剂合理选择以及设备优化等措施可大大减少断线的发生,可实现超细铜线的正常生产。
【Abstract】 Ultra-fine copper wire is a kind of high-tech products,has wide application prospect.But its production difficult, often in the production process is broken,troubled by their normal production.Based on the analysis of Break’s the microscopic fracture during ultra-fine copper wire drawing process,explore the causes of Break that causes break,including copper billet vents,loose,inclusions,surface defects,deficiencies,and plastic deformation of copper uneven deformation force is too large,die wear and tear,such as equipment,precision and smoothness.In a large number of defect analysis and industrial practice based on the proposed disconnection of the countermeasures that preferred by raw materials,mold optimization,a reasonable choice of lubricants and equipment optimization measures can greatly reduce the incidence of disconnection, enabling the normal ultra-fine copper wire produce.
